CVE-2017-17153 describes a memory leak vulnerability in Huawei IPS, NGFW, NIP, Secospace USG, and USG9500 products across various V500R001C00 and V500R001C20 versions. This flaw stems from insufficient input validation in the IKEv2 component, leading to memory release failures. With a CVSS score of 7.5 (HIGH), this vulnerability can be exploited remotely without authentication (A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N) to cause a denial of service through system exceptions (A:H). There is no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code, or significant community discussion surrounding this CVE.
